Key Features Comparison

SCIENTILLA
SCIENTILLA Features
  • Syntax highlighting for multiple programming languages
  • Code folding
  • Auto-completion of code
  • Support for macros
  • Multiple cursors
  • Project management
  • Version control integration
  • Extensible via plugins
WebNotes
WebNotes Features
  • WYSIWYG text editor
  • Notebooks for organizing notes
  • Tags for categorizing notes
  • Real-time collaboration
  • Cross-device sync
  • Unlimited storage
  • Search notes
  • Attach files
  • User dashboard

Pros & Cons Analysis

SCIENTILLA
SCIENTILLA
Pros
  • Free and open source
  • Lightweight and fast
  • Designed specifically for coding and technical writing
  • Highly customizable
Cons
  • Limited built-in features compared to full IDEs
  • Less user-friendly than text editors aimed at general users
  • Smaller community than mainstream text editors
WebNotes
WebNotes
Pros
  • Free
  • Intuitive and easy to use
  • Good collaboration features
  • Unlimited storage
  • Available on all devices
Cons
  • Limited formatting options
  • No offline access
  • No mobile apps
  • Lacks advanced features like reminders
